A triangle has dimensions 5, 7, and 11. A similar triangle is drawn with a scale factor of 1.4. What are the dimensions of the n

ew triangle?
A. 5, 7, and 11
B. 7, 9.8, and 15.4
C. 10, 14, and 22
D6.4, 8.4, and 12.4
Mathematics
2 answers:
arsen [322]3 years ago
6 0
The answer is B. you need to multiply 5,7, and 11 by 1.4

PLZ HELP AND SHOW YOUR WORK &lt;3333<br><br><br> Substitution.<br><br> 3x+2y=11<br><br> y=5x-1
liraira [26]
Hey there! :D

Substitute y for 5x-1. 

3x+2y=11

y=5x-1

3x+2(5x-1)=11

3x+10x-2=11

13x-2=11

13x=13

x=1

Now, plug that in to find y.

y=5x-1

y=5(1)-1

y=5-1

y=4

(1,4) <== the solution
